McPherson Burden was born in 1869 in Butler County, Kentucky, United States of America, the child of Ely Embry Burden And Minerva Jane Swift. In 1870, McPherson Burden resided in Precinct 5, Butler, Kentucky, USA. In 1880, McPherson Burden resided in Burdens, Butler, Kentucky, USA. McPherson Burden married Drusilla P Kessinger, Nicey Burden, and had children including James Corbett Burden, John L Sullivan Burden, Martha Elzany Burden, Minerva Catherine Burden. McPherson Burden passed away in 1899 in Morgantown, Butler County, Kentucky, United States of America.
